feat(call): implement CallConnection with imported-ops overlay (Layer 2) and call/subscribe/abort methods
Implements CallConnection in src/protocol/connection.rs representing an established alknet/call connection (either direction). Holds the Layer 2 imported-ops overlay (ADR-024) as Arc<RwLock<HashMap>>. - register_imported / register_imported_all add to the connection overlay - overlay_env returns an OperationEnv dispatching to imported ops; contains() returns true only for ops in the overlay - call() opens a stream, sends call.requested, registers in PendingRequestMap, spawns a stream reader, resolves on first call.responded - subscribe() sends call.requested and yields call.responded until call.completed/call.aborted via a SubscriptionStream wrapping the mpsc receiver - abort() sends call.aborted for the request ID and removes the pending entry - connection drop drops the overlay (no explicit deregistration needed) Exposes MockConnection trait and Connection::from_mock in alknet-core so cross-crate tests can construct mock connections without real QUIC. Removes two unused test helpers in env.rs that triggered dead-code warnings under -D warnings. Adds parking_lot dep for the overlay RwLock and pending Mutex. 9 new connection tests (102 total in alknet-call). Clippy clean.
